انجمن انیاک
آموزش توابع و فرمول نویسی Excel 2013 - قسمت سوم - نسخه‌ی قابل چاپ

+- انجمن انیاک (http://forum.learninweb.com)
+-- انجمن: آموزش های تصویری (/forumdisplay.php?fid=7)
+--- انجمن: آموزش تصویری توابع اکسل (/forumdisplay.php?fid=15)
+--- موضوع: آموزش توابع و فرمول نویسی Excel 2013 - قسمت سوم (/showthread.php?tid=1057)



آموزش توابع و فرمول نویسی Excel 2013 - قسمت سوم - learninweb - 06-01-2015 07:21 PM

با سلام خدمت تمامي کاربران گرامي در زير آموزش تصويري توابع Excel 2013 را بررسي ميکنيم توجه کنيد که شما ميتوانيد نرم افزار آموزش توابع Excel 2013 را به همراه چند بخش آموزشي ديگر که بصورت تعاملي و شبيه سازي شده با صدا و متن فارسي درس داده شده است و رايگان نيز ميباشد از لينک آموزش توابع Excel 2013 دانلود کنيد. در نرم افزارهاي آموزشي کارهاي بيان شده را بايد در محيط شبيه سازي شده انجام دهيد. در ابتدا و انتهاي اين آموزش تصويري نيز کل آموزش (هم متن و هم تصويري) در فايل PDF و Word موجود است.

دانلود فایل pdf آموزش تصویری توابع Excel 2013
دانلود فایل word آموزش تصویری توابع Excel 2013

در اين فصل به معرفي توابعي که مرتبط به خطا‌ها هستند مي‌پردازيم. اولين تابعي که مي‌خواهيم معرفي کنيم تابع ISERROR است. در صورتيکه مقدار ورودي اين تابع خطا نداشته باشد عبارت False نمايش داده مي‌شود و اگر عبارت ورودي تابع خطا داشته باشد عبارت True نمايش داده مي‌شود. براي آشنايي بيشتر به مثالي که در ادامه بيان مي‌کنيم توجه کنيد.
در اين مثال مي‌خواهيم عدد 255 تقسيم بر 5 کنيم.
مي‌خواهيم ببينيم آيا اين عبارت حاوي مشکل است و خطا دارد يا خير. براي اين کار روي سلول A1 دابل کليک کنيد.
[تصویر:  001.gif]

در ادامه دستور =ISERROR(255/5) را وارد مي‌کنيم.
دکمه Enter صفحه کليد را فشار دهيد.
[تصویر:  002.gif]

همانطور که مشاهده مي‌کنيد چون تقسيم دو عدد 255 و 5 صحيح مي‌باشد و به مشکلي بر نمي‌خورد عبارت False به نمايش در آمده است. اکنون روي سلول A1 دابل کليک کنيد.
[تصویر:  003.gif]

در ادامه عبارت داخل تابع را از (255/5) به (255/0) تغيير مي‌دهيم.
چون تقسيم عدد 255 بر صفر يک خطا مي‌باشد، بايد عبارت True نمايش داده شود. دکمه Enter صفحه کليد را فشار دهيد
[تصویر:  004.gif]

همانطور که مشاهده مي‌کنيد، عبارت True به نمايش در آمده است و نشان مي‌دهد که عبارت وارد شده در آن داراي خطا مي باشد.
[تصویر:  005.gif]

يکي ديگر از توابع مربوط به خطا‌ها در اکسل‌، تابع ERROR.TYPE مي‌باشد که اين تابع به جاي نمايش ERROR، يک عدد نمايش مي‌دهد که هر عدد نمايانگر يک خطا است است. اعدادي که نمايش داده مي‌شود مطابق جدول زير هستند:
همانطور که مي‌‌بينيد، در سلول A1 يک پيغام خطا وجود دارد. ما مي‌خواهيم شماره پيغام خطا را در سلول B1 نمايش دهيم براي اين کار در ادامه تابع =ERROR.TYPE(A1) را در سلول B1 وارد مي‌کنيم.
[تصویر:  006.gif]

دکمه Enter صفحه کليد را فشار دهيد.
[تصویر:  007.gif]

همانطور که مشاهده مي‌کنيد، عدد 5 را به نمايش گذاشته است.
[تصویر:  008.gif]

گاهي اوقات شما مي‌خواهيد ببينيد عبارت موجود در يک سلول عدد است يا خير براي اين کار از تابع ISNUMBER استفاده مي‌کنيم. براي مثال همانطور که مي‌بينيد در سلول A1 عدد قرار دارد و در سلول A2 متن قرار دارد. حالا به ترتيب اين دو سلول را مورد بررسي قرار مي‌دهيم. روي سلول B1 کليک کنيد.
[تصویر:  009.gif]

در ادامه دستور =ISNUMBER(A1) را وارد مي‌کنيم.
براي آنکه مشاهده کنيم محتواي A1 آيا برابر عدد است يا خير، دکمه Enter صفحه کليد را فشار دهيد.
[تصویر:  010.gif]

همانطور که مي‌بينيد عبارت TRUE به نمايش گذاشته شده است. در ادامه دستور =ISNUMBER(A2) را در سلول B2 وارد مي‌کنيم.
[تصویر:  011.gif]

براي مشاهده نتيجه خروجي تابع دکمه Enter صفحه کليد را فشار دهيد.
[تصویر:  012.gif]

چون محتواي سلول A2 برابر عدد نمي‌باشد عبارت FALSE يا نادرست به نمايش گذاشته شده است.
[تصویر:  013.gif]

در بعضي از مواقع مي‌خواهيد بدانيد عدد موجود در يک سلول آيا زوج است يا خير براي اين کار از تابع ISEVEN استفاده مي‌کنيم. براي مثال در ادامه دستور =ISEVEN( را وارد مي‌کنيم.
عدد زوج عدد 2012 را وارد نماييد.
کاراکتر ) را وارد کنيد.
براي آنکه محاسبه کنيم عدد 2012 آيا زوج است يا خير، دکمه Enter صفحه کليد را فشار دهيد.
[تصویر:  014.gif]

همانطور که مي‌بينيد عبارت True به نمايش گذاشته شده است که مشخص مي‌کنيد اين عدد زوج مي‌باشد. شما مي‌توانيد به جاي عدد داخل سلول آدرس سلول مورد نظر خود را نيز وارد نماييد.
[تصویر:  015.gif]

در بعضي مواقع ممکن است شما بخواهيد بدانيد عدد موجود در يک سلول فرد است يا خير براي اين کار از تابع ISODD استفاده مي‌کنيم. طريقه استفاده از اين تابع همانند تابع ISEVEN مي‌باشد. براي درک بهتر ما تابع =ISODD(20) را در سلول F3 وارد کرده‌ايم. اکنون دکمه Enter صفحه کليد را فشار دهيد تا نتيجه کار را مشاهده نماييد.
[تصویر:  016.gif]

همانطور که مي‌بينيد عبارت False به نمايش گذاشته است و به اين معنا است که عدد وارد شده فرد نمي‌باشد. شما مي‌توانيد به جاي عدد داخل سلول آدرس سلول مورد نظر را نيز وارد نماييد.
[تصویر:  017.gif]

تابع N هر عبارتي را به عدد تبديل مي‌کند. براي درک بهتر اين تابع جدول رو برو را مشاهده کنيد.
اکنون مي‌خواهيم ببينيم عبارت true به چه عددي تبديل مي‌شود براي اين کار، روي سلول A1 دابل کليک کنيد.
[تصویر:  018.gif]

عبارت true را تايپ نماييد.
براي استفاده از تابع N روي سلول B1 کليک کنيد.
[تصویر:  019.gif]

در ادامه دستور =N(A1) را وارد مي‌کنيم.
دکمه Enter صفحه کليد را فشار دهيد.
[تصویر:  020.gif]

همانطور که مشاهده مي‌کنيد عبارت true به عدد 1 تبديل شده است.
[تصویر:  021.gif]

تابع ISBLANK مشخص مي‌کند که آيا محتواي يک سلول خالي است يا خير. براي درک بهتر جدول روبرو را مشاهده نماييد.
همانطور که مشاهده مي‌کنيد داخل سلول A1 هيچ عبارتي وجود ندارد. براي بررسي اين موضوع روي سلول B1 کليک کنيد.
[تصویر:  022.gif]

در ادامه دستور =ISBLANK(A1) را وارد مي‌کنيم.
دکمه Enter صفحه کليد را فشار دهيد.
[تصویر:  023.gif]

همانطور که مشاهده ‌مي‌کنيد، عبارت True که نشان‌دهنده خالي بودن سلول A1 است به نمايش در آمده است.
[تصویر:  024.gif]

از تابع ISLOGICAL براي اين که محاسبه شود يک عبارت، عبارت منطقي است يا خير استفاده مي کنيم. به اين ترتيب اگر جواب يک عبارت وارد شده در داخل اين تابع برابر درست يا نادرست باشد عبارت TRUE نمايش داده مي‌شود و اگر جواب معادله‌ي وارد شده در داخل اين تابع غير از درست يا نادرست باشد عبارت FALSE نمايش داده مي‌شود. براي آشنايي بيشتر به مثال‌هاي روبرو توجه نماييد.
[تصویر:  025.gif]

حالا روي سلول A1 دابل کليک کنيد.
[تصویر:  026.gif]

در ادامه دستور =ISLOGICAL( 20/5) را وارد مي‌کنيم.
چون جواب معادله قرار داده شده در تابع يک عدد مي‌باشد بايد بعد از فشار دادن کليد Enter صفحه کليد، عبارت False به نمايش در بيايد. دکمه Enter صفحه کليد را فشار دهيد.
[تصویر:  027.gif]

همانطور که مشاهده مي‌‌کنيد عبارت False به نمايش در آمده است.
[تصویر:  028.gif]

يکي از توابعي که ما را در شناسايي توابعي که داراي متن مي‌باشد ياري مي‌کند، تابع ISTEXT است. اگر در سلول مورد نظر متن وجود داشته باشد عبارت True و در غير اين صورت عبارت FALSE نشان داده مي‌شود. براي مثال روي سلول A1 دابل کليک کنيد.
[تصویر:  029.gif]

در ادامه دستور =ISTEXT("shahin") را وارد مي‌‌کنيم.
دکمه Enter صفحه کليد را فشار دهيد.
[تصویر:  030.gif]

همانطور که مشاهده مي‌کنيد عبارت True به نمايش در آمده است.
[تصویر:  031.gif]

از تابع ISNONTEXT براي عدم وجود متن در يک سلول استفاده مي‌شود. اگر در يک سلول متن وجود نداشته باشد عبارت TRUE و در غير اين صورت عبارت FALSE برگردانده مي‌شود. براي مثال روي سلول B1 کليک کنيد.
[تصویر:  032.gif]

در ادامه دستور =ISNONTEXT("ENIAC") را وارد مي‌کنيم.
دکمه Enter صفحه کليد را فشار دهيد.
[تصویر:  033.gif]

همانطور که مشاهده مي‌کنيد چون عبارت داخل تابع متن بود عبارت False به نمايش در آمده است.
[تصویر:  034.gif]

در اين قسمت به سراغ تابع ISREF مي‌رويم. اين تابع مقدار وارد شده را چک مي‌کند تا مشخص کند که عبارت وارد شده يک محدوده از سلول‌ها است يا خير. اگر مقدار وارد شده يک محدوده بود عبارت True و در غير اين صورت عبارت False به نمايش در مي‌آيد.
براي بررسي يک مثال روي سلول C1 کليک کنيد
[تصویر:  035.gif]

در ادامه دستور =ISREF(B1) را وارد مي‌کنيم.
همانطور که مشاهده مي‌کنيد آدرس سلول B1 را وارد کرده‌ايم به همين دليل بعد از فشار دادن دکمه Enter بايد عبارت True نمايش داده شود. دکمه Enter صفحه کليد را فشار بدهيد.
[تصویر:  036.gif]

همانطور که مشاهده مي‌کنيد، عبارت True به نمايش در آمده است.
[تصویر:  037.gif]

در ادامه به معرفي تابع ISFORMULA ميپردازيم. اين تابع وظيفه دارد که بررسي کند آيا داخل سلول مورد نظر از تابع يا فرمولي استفاده شده است يا خير. براي درک بهتر اين تابع در ادامه به ذکر يک مثال ميپردازيم.
مشاهده ميکنيد که در سلول B1 تابع TODAY را وارد کرده ايم که تاريخ امروز را نشان ميدهيد و در سلول B3 تاريخ امروز را به صورت دستي وارد کردهايم و در مقابل هر کدام تابع ISFORMULA را وارد کردهايم که بررسي کند کدام سلول داراي تابع ميباشد. حال براي نمايش خروجي روي دکمه Enter صفحه کليد کليک کنيد.
[تصویر:  038.gif]

همانطور که ميبينيد سلول B1 که داراي تابع بود خروجي آن True شده و سلول B3 که بدون تابع بود خروجي آن برابر False شده است.
[تصویر:  039.gif]

حالا به سراغ تابع TYPE مي‌رويم. با استفاده از اين تابع مي‌توان تشخيص داد در داخل هر سلول چه نوع محتوايي وجود دارد (text، number، error value و ...). براي نمايش کاراکتر موجود در سلول از اعداد خاصي استفاده مي‌شود که به صورت جدول روبرو است.
همانطور که مشاهده مي‌کنيد، در سلول B1 خطاي #DIV/0! که حاصل تقسيم يک عدد بر صفر است قرار دارد. حالا روي سلول A1 کليک نماييد تا تابع TYPE را وارد کنيم و عدد مرتبط با محتواي سلول B1 را مشاهده کنيد. روي سلول A1 کليک کنيد.
[تصویر:  040.gif]

در ادامه دستور =TYPE(B1) را وارد مي‌کنيم. همانطور که مي‌بينيد به جاي قرار دادن عبارتي داخل پرانتز از آدرس سلول استفاده شده است.
دکمه Enter صفحه کليد را فشار دهيد.
[تصویر:  041.gif]

همانطور که مشاهده مي‌کنيد، عدد 16 نمايش داده شده است که مشخص مي‌کند عبارت موجود در سلول B1 يک پيغام خطا مي‌باشد.
[تصویر:  042.gif]

تابع CELL هر نوع اطلاعاتي که در مورد سلول را ممکن است نياز داشته باشيم در اختيار ما قرار مي‌دهد. شکل کلي اين تابع به صورت زير است.
CELL( info_type, reference )‌
در ادامه به معرفي بخش‌هاي مختلف اين تابع مي‌پردازيم:
info_type: در قسمت info_type يکي از عبارات زير را وارد مي‌کنيم. توضيح هر عبارت در روبروي آن نوشته شده است.
• "address": آدرس سلول را نمايش مي‌دهد.
• "col": نشان مي‌دهد چندمين سلول است.
•"color": اگر سلول مورد نظر منفي يا قرمز باشدعدد 1 و در غير اين صورت 0 را نشان مي‌دهد.
•"contents": مقدار موجود در سلول مورد نظر را نمايش مي‌دهد.
• "filename": نام فايل را نشان مي‌دهد.
• "format": مشخص مي‌کند سلول مورد نظر ما داراي چه سبکي است.
• "parentheses":
•"prefix":
•"protect":
• "row": نشان‌دهنده شماره رديف سلول
• "type":
•"width": عرض سلول مورد نظر را نشان مي‌دهد.
•Reference :آدرس سلول مورد نظر را مشخص مي‌کنيم.
اکنون براي درک بهتر اين تابع به اين مثال توجه کنيد.
همانطور که مشاهده مي‌کنيد در سلول A1 عدد
-9,999 وارد شده است. براي وارد کردن تابع روي سلول B1 کليک کنيد.
[تصویر:  043.gif]

مي‌خواهيم آدرس سلول را مشاهده کنيم براي اين کار در ادامه دستور=CELL("address",A1) را وارد مي‌کنيم.
دکمه Enter صفحه کليد را فشار دهيد.
[تصویر:  044.gif]

همانطور که مشاهده مي‌کنيد آدرس سلول به نمايش در آمده است.
[تصویر:  045.gif]

يکي ديگر از توابعي که به اکسل 2013 اضافه شده است تابع SHEET ميباشد. فرض کنيد که فايل اکسل شما داراي تعداد زيادي Sheet ميباشد. براي اين که بدانيد شيت مورد نظر شما چندمين شيت در اين فايل ميباشد از اين تابع استفاده ميکنيم. همان طور که ميبينيد که سه Sheet با نامهاي aaa، bbb و ccc ايجاد کردهايم. حال ميخواهيم بدانيم شيت bbb چندمين Sheet در فايل اکسل ميباشد. براي اينکار در ادامه تابع =SHEET(“bbb”) را تايپ ميکنيم.
حال دکمه Enter صفحه کليد را فشار دهيد.
[تصویر:  046.gif]

مشاهد ميکنيد که عدد 2 به نمايش در آمده است و نشان ميدهد که Sheet bbb دومين Sheet در فايل اکسل ميباشد.
[تصویر:  047.gif]

تابع SHEETS نيز به تازگي در اکسل 2013 قرار گرفته است. وظيفه تابع SHEETS اين است که مشخص ميکند در اين فايل اکسل چند Sheet وجود دارد. همان‌طور که مشاهده ميکنيد تابع =SHEETS() را وارد کردهايم. حال روي دکمه Enter صفحه کليد را فشار دهيد تا مشخص شود چند Sheet در اين فايل اکسل وجود دارد.
[تصویر:  048.gif]

مشاهده ميکنيد که عدد سه به نمايش در آمده و مشخص ميکند که اين فايل داراي سه sheet ميباشد.
[تصویر:  049.gif]

تابع ديگري که مي‌خواهيم به شما معرفي کنيم تابع INFO مي‌باشد که مشخصات سيستم را به ما مي‌دهد که شکل کلي آن به صورت زير است:
INFO( type_text ) ‌
با توجه به مقداري که در قسمت type_text قرار مي‌دهيد، خروجي آن در جدول زير مشخص شده است.براي بررسي يک مثال روي سلول A1 دابل کليک نماييد.
[تصویر:  050.gif]

براي مشاهده مشخصات وضعيت حالت recalc دستور =INFO("recalc") را وارد مي‌کنيم.
دکمه Enter صفحه کليد را فشار دهيد.
[تصویر:  051.gif]

مشاهده مي‌کنيد که عبارت Automatic به نمايش گذاشته شده است.
[تصویر:  052.gif]

در انتهاي اين بخش به معرفي تابع NA مي‌پردازيم که خروجي آن پيغام خطاي#N/A مي‌باشد. براي مثال روي سلول C3 کليک کنيد.
[تصویر:  053.gif]

دستور =NA() را تايپ کنيد.
دکمه Enter صفحه کليد را فشار دهيد.
[تصویر:  054.gif]

همانطور که مشاهده مي‌کنيد پيغام خطاي مورد نظر نمايش داده شده است.کاربر گرامي، شما اکنون در پايان اين بخش هستيد،
[تصویر:  055.gif]


توجه کنيد که شما ميتوانيد نرم افزار آموزش توابع Excel 2013 را به همراه چند بخش آموزشي ديگر که بصورت تعاملي و شبيه سازي شده با صدا و متن فارسي درس داده شده است و رايگان نيز ميباشد از لينک آموزش توابع Excel 2013 دانلود کنيد. در نرم افزارهاي آموزشي کارهاي بيان شده را بايد در محيط شبيه سازي شده انجام دهيد. در ابتدا و انتهاي اين آموزش تصويري نيز کل آموزش (هم متن و هم تصويري) در فايل PDF و Word موجود است.

دانلود فایل pdf آموزش تصویری توابع Excel 2013
دانلود فایل word آموزش تصویری توابع Excel 2013